Description

This 1883 white metal medal at 38mm commemorates the 17th Annual Encampment of the Grand Army of the Republic (G.A.R.) in Denver, Colorado. The G.A.R. was the largest Union veteran organization, and its annual encampments attracted tens of thousands. The 1883 Denver encampment was significant as one of the first major G.A.R. gatherings in the West. White metal was standard for encampment badges. G.A.R.
